Plant Care & Growing Tips

Caring for your canna lily palaska is a rewarding experience, leading to a spectacular display of white blooms. To ensure optimal growth, provide plenty of sunlight. Canna lilies thrive in full sun, meaning at least 6-8 hours of direct sunlight per day. In hotter climates, some afternoon shade can be beneficial to prevent leaf scorch. When planting, choose a location with rich, well-draining soil. These plants are heavy feeders and appreciate soil amended with organic matter like compost. Consistent moisture is crucial for canna lilies, especially during their active growing and blooming periods. Water regularly, ensuring the soil remains evenly moist but not waterlogged. Avoid letting the soil dry out completely between waterings.

For best performance, fertilize your canna lily palaska every 2-4 weeks during the growing season with a balanced liquid fertilizer or a slow-release granular fertilizer. Deadhead spent flowers to encourage more blooms and maintain a tidy appearance. In USDA zones 7 and below, canna lily rhizomes are typically lifted and stored indoors over winter to protect them from freezing temperatures. In warmer zones (USDA zones 8 and above), they can remain in the ground year-round. Watch out for common pests like canna leaf rollers; prompt treatment with organic pesticides can help manage infestations. Proper care will ensure a stunning display of white canna lily flowers.

Canna lilies are fast-growing plants, and with proper care, this variety can reach an impressive height of 3-5 feet with a spread of 1-2 feet, making it a prominent feature in your landscape. Expect the plant to begin blooming in early summer and continue producing its beautiful angelic canna lily flowers until the first hard frost. The rhizome, the underground stem from which the plant grows, is robust and will establish quickly in suitable conditions, leading to a magnificent display within its first growing season.
